The Farewell
The thunder pounded the skies with flash and rumble,
as rain fell in torrents on friends and loved ones,
as we stood in mournful silence,
It was as if God had rolled open the floodgates of heaven
to ensure your vessel passage across the river to stand before the throne.
I thought such a blessing had been taken from this life,
and entered into the next,
where there is no sorrow, tears or pain,
only life and abundant joy.
My dearest your struggle is over, your reward is great,
for God so loved you, and so favored your heart.
We all stood in congregation, gathered for your journey home.
Our faces comprised a sad smile, some with tears flowing in abundance,
while others stood solemnly behind eyes distant and withholding.
My heart ached with the reality of you no longer being present.
It also ached for all gathered,
I knew they were all pained in the same terrible grief.
My pain intensified for those dearest,
who love you as no other can, for whom in this instant
I found my protection of their tender hearts incomplete.
I could find no words or embrace, nor tears that could heal their hearts.
In silent prayer I glorified God for your earthly life that he lovingly shared with us,
while earnestly seeking the Father to comfort your sweet ones who love you so.
Wife, Mother, Grandmother, Sister, Aunt, Cousin, Mother-in- Law and Dear Friend.
In all these appointments you exceeded the standard of love and care.
For all my days, I will cherish the lovely heart and soul,
which God blessed me to encounter in my journey.
Your farewell was bound to be, I know,
just as all of us are one day to make the sojourn.
Yet, even with the knowledge that all of us will eventually bid farewell
when our journey here is through,
still my heart weeps at the thought of the farewell to you.
©Davey Moore 2013
